In a recent statement, Tim Cook shared his thoughts on how he wants to be remembered after his time at Apple. He emphasized the importance of integrity and decency in leadership, indicating that he prioritizes being seen as a good person over any purely business achievements. This concern for personal legacy speaks to broader themes of leadership ethics in the tech industry.
